You mentioned that you are trying to find more articles about subjects, like "leadership traits."  This is a very broad subject and should bring a large number of results when you search for these keywords.  Many of them will be relevant to you, but many will not. The best strategy is to try to narrow the results according to your topic. 

If you enter leadership traits in the search bar on the Library home page:

You will end up with about 230,000 results on the next page.

Think about additional keywords you can add to narrow your focus.  For example, if you are interested in leadership traits of managers or executives or politicians, then you could add the keywords, like this:

This simple addition would bring the results to about 96,000.  It may seem like less, but now your results are more focused on your topic. You can limit your searching in other ways, too, such as checking various boxes in the Refine your search section of the results.  You may wish to limit to just journal articles or books, or maybe you want to set the publication dates to just the last five years for more current material.
